Types Of Relays In Athletics. The world athletics relays is held over two days and now becomes make or break for national teams as they compete in five olympic relay. The first olympic 4x100m relay for men was held in 1912; Relays is a type of track and field event where a team of athletes runs a predetermined distance and passes batons so that the next person can continue the race. In the 4x100m relay, each runner covers 100 meters, while in the 4x400m relay, each runner covers 400. The most common relay race types are the 4x100m and 4x400m relays.
